repo.or.cz
/
helenos.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Remove dead code
2018-03-13
Jakub Jermar
Remove
d
ead co
d
e
commit
|
commitdiff
|
tree
2018-03-13
J
a
kub
J
e
r
mar
Give reference t
o
phone for eac
h
active
call
commit
|
commitdiff
|
tree
2018-03-13
J
akub Jerm
a
r
Remove support fo
r
cap
a
bility reclaiming
commit
|
commitdiff
|
tree
2018-03-12
Jak
u
b Jer
m
a
r
ia64:
No need to allo
c
ate an extra
l
ocal r
e
gister
commit
|
commitdiff
|
tree
2018-03-06
Jakub J
e
r
ma
r
ew
.
py: disa
b
le XHCI and USB ta
b
let on
s
parc64
commit
|
commitdiff
|
tree
2018-03-06
Jakub
Jermar
ew
.
py: d
i
sable XHCI and USB ta
b
let on arm32/icp
commit
|
commitdiff
|
tree
2018-02-28
Jakub Jerm
a
r
Merge github
.
com:heleno
s
-xhci-tea
m
/
h
elenos
commit
|
commitdiff
|
tree
2018-02-15
Jakub Jermar
boot
/
arm32:
Fix commen
t
commit
|
commitdiff
|
tree
2018-02-13
Ja
k
ub
J
ermar
i8259: Do not
u
se
magic num
b
ers
commit
|
commitdiff
|
tree
2017-12-22
Jakub
J
e
r
ma
r
Introduce I
P
C_CALL_AUTO_REPLY call fla
g
commit
|
commitdiff
|
tree
2017-12-20
Jakub Je
r
mar
Run the tools/
c
c
.
sh scr
i
pt dur
i
n
g
release
commit
|
commitdiff
|
tree
2017-12-20
Ja
k
ub Jermar
Add
scri
p
t to comply wit
h
3-BS
D
on release
commit
|
commitdiff
|
tree
2017-12-20
Jak
u
b Jermar
Revert "Reformat copyright message
s
"
commit
|
commitdiff
|
tree
2017-12-19
Jakub J
e
rmar
Re
f
ormat copyright messages
commit
|
commitdiff
|
tree
2017-12-19
Jakub Jermar
Reformat
c
omment
commit
|
commitdiff
|
tree
2017-12-19
Jaku
b
Jermar
Rem
o
ve irrelevant
t
e
xt
commit
|
commitdiff
|
tree
2017-12-19
Jakub
Jermar
Fix typo
commit
|
commitdiff
|
tree
2017-12-13
Jakub J
e
rmar
Merge branch 'sun4u_qemu
_
2
.
11'
commit
|
commitdiff
|
tree
2017-12-13
Jaku
b
Jer
m
ar
Up
g
r
a
d
e
to QEMU 2
.
11
.
0
commit
|
commitdiff
|
tree
2017-12-05
Jakub Je
r
ma
r
Rem
o
ve dead code
commit
|
commitdiff
|
tree
2017-12-05
Jakub Jer
m
ar
Remov
e
IPC_C
A
LLID_* macros
commit
|
commitdiff
|
tree
2017-12-05
Jakub Jermar
Fix termin
o
l
ogy
commit
|
commitdiff
|
tree
2017-11-27
Jakub Jermar
Con
v
ert
g
r
ub-update
.
s
h
script
to us
i
ng git
commit
|
commitdiff
|
tree
2017-11-27
Jakub Je
r
m
a
r
Co
n
vert the release M
a
kefile to using git
commit
|
commitdiff
|
tree
2017-11-26
Jaku
b
Jermar
Fix wrong
l
y-inverted
condition
commit
|
commitdiff
|
tree
2017-11-26
Jakub
J
ermar
Use ordi
n
ary err
o
rs instead o
f
IPC_
C
ALLRET_F
A
TAL
commit
|
commitdiff
|
tree
2017-11-26
Jakub
Jermar
Do not
l
eak c
a
l
l
address in sys_ipc
_
call_async_*(
)
commit
|
commitdiff
|
tree
2017-11-25
Jaku
b
J
ermar
F
r
e
e up all call cap
a
bilities when
task exits
commit
|
commitdiff
|
tree
2017-11-25
Jak
u
b Jermar
Me
n
tion IPC calls in the comment on
capabilities
commit
|
commitdiff
|
tree
2017-11-25
Jaku
b
Jermar
Co
n
vert call-han
d
lin
g
syscalls to capabilities
commit
|
commitdiff
|
tree
2017-11-25
Jakub
Jerma
r
Move c
a
p_han
d
le
_
t to abi
/
c
a
p
.
h
commit
|
commitdiff
|
tree
2017-11-25
J
akub
J
ermar
Merge branch 'master' into callcap
s
commit
|
commitdiff
|
tree
2017-11-24
Jakub Jermar
Add
C
AP_
N
IL
commit
|
commitdiff
|
tree
2017-11-23
Jakub Jermar
Retur
n
I
P
C
_CALLI
D
_* in call data inst
e
ad of calli
d
commit
|
commitdiff
|
tree
2017-11-23
Ja
k
ub Jermar
S
i
m
plify ip
c
_call_async
_
fast()
commit
|
commitdiff
|
tree
2017-11-23
Jak
u
b
J
ermar
Rework userspace c
a
l
l
t
r
acking
commit
|
commitdiff
|
tree
2017-11-23
Jakub Jermar
Remove u
n
used member of async_call_t
commit
|
commitdiff
|
tree
2017-11-23
Jakub Jerm
a
r
Remove support for que
u
ing of unsent calls
commit
|
commitdiff
|
tree
2017-11-21
J
a
kub Jermar
Associate a kobject_t
w
ith a
call_t
commit
|
commitdiff
|
tree
2017-11-16
Ja
k
ub Jerm
a
r
Remo
v
e t
h
e Simi
c
s S
M
P
hack
commit
|
commitdiff
|
tree
2017-11-16
Jakub
Jermar
Use prope
r
PRI* macr
o
t
o
print OBIO base in h
e
x
commit
|
commitdiff
|
tree
2017-11-15
Jak
u
b Jermar
Inc
l
u
d
e mips32/
m
alta-
l
e in the r
e
lease Make
f
ile
commit
|
commitdiff
|
tree
2017-11-15
Ja
k
ub
J
e
r
mar
Adapt to th
e
imp
r
oved
s
un4u model in QEMU 2
.
11
commit
|
commitdiff
|
tree
2017-11-15
Jakub Je
r
m
a
r
Remove support
for Bazaar f
r
o
m contrib
commit
|
commitdiff
|
tree
2017-11-13
J
akub
Jermar
Make tools/*
.
py scripts Git
aware
commit
|
commitdiff
|
tree
2017-11-12
Jaku
b
Jermar
Bump vers
i
on
t
o 0
.
7
.
1
commit
|
commitdiff
|
tree
2017-11-12
J
a
k
ub Jermar
Include t
h
e versi
o
n
m
akefile again
commit
|
commitdiff
|
tree
2017-11-12
Jakub Jermar
M
ake assembler wa
r
nings fa
t
al aga
i
n for all archite
c
tures
commit
|
commitdiff
|
tree
2017-11-12
Jakub Jermar
Add stop
befor
e
call to
h
onor depe
n
denc
i
es from alloc
commit
|
commitdiff
|
tree
2017-11-12
Jaku
b
Jer
m
ar
Use %g1 in
s
te
a
d
of %g0 a
s
a
t
e
m
po
r
ary
regi
s
t
er i
n
s
e
tx
commit
|
commitdiff
|
tree
2017-11-11
Jakub Je
r
mar
Properly
e
nd f
u
nctions s
t
arted via
.
ent
commit
|
commitdiff
|
tree
2017-11-11
J
a
kub Jermar
Allow expa
n
sion of macro i
n
s
t
ructions
commit
|
commitdiff
|
tree
2017-11-10
J
akub Jermar
Buil
d
msim-con
commit
|
commitdiff
|
tree
2017-11-10
Jakub Jerm
a
r
Remove
support for I
P
C_C
A
LLRE
T
_
T
EMPO
R
ARY
commit
|
commitdiff
|
tree
2017-11-09
Ja
k
ub J
e
r
mar
Answer IPC only when there will be no bl
o
cking
commit
|
commitdiff
|
tree
2017-11-09
J
a
kub Jerm
a
r
F
i
rst
wa
i
t for IPC
answer and then en
d
the asyn
c
exchange
commit
|
commitdiff
|
tree
2017-11-09
Jakub
J
erm
a
r
Make I
N
TERFACE_LOC_
S
UPPLIER parallel
commit
|
commitdiff
|
tree
2017-11-09
Ja
k
u
b Jermar
Ma
k
e
k
er
n
el IPC fail ha
r
d if m
a
ximum numbe
r
of calls
.
.
.
commit
|
commitdiff
|
tree
2017-11-09
Jakub Jer
m
a
r
Bump IPC_MAX_ASYN
C
_CALLS
commit
|
commitdiff
|
tree
2017-11-01
Jakub Jermar
Remove de
a
d
code
commit
|
commitdiff
|
tree
2017-11-01
Jakub Jermar
Use
p
r
o
per PI
O
and
i
oport64_t interfa
c
es in
obio
commit
|
commitdiff
|
tree
2017-11-01
Jakub Jermar
Add 64-bit P
I
O
fun
c
tions
commit
|
commitdiff
|
tree
2017-11-01
Jakub Jermar
Do not attempt
to start
/srv/obio
commit
|
commitdiff
|
tree
2017-10-28
Jakub Jermar
Use rec
u
rsive mutex to prot
e
c
t
task
_
t
:
:
c
ap_info
commit
|
commitdiff
|
tree
2017-10-28
Jakub Jermar
I
m
plement
recursi
v
e mutex
commit
|
commitdiff
|
tree
2017-10-28
Jakub Je
r
mar
U
npublish a
n
d fre
e
phone a
n
d IRQ capab
i
lities in ipc_clea
n
u
p()
commit
|
commitdiff
|
tree
2017-10-28
Jakub Jermar
D
rop phone kobject refer
e
nce when
slamming th
e
phone
.
.
.
commit
|
commitdiff
|
tree
2017-10-28
Jakub Jermar
Maintain
p
hon
e
kobje
c
t reference for call_t::
c
a
l
ler_ph
o
ne
commit
|
commitdiff
|
tree
2017-10-28
Jak
u
b Jermar
Provide locked ver
s
ions of cap_unpu
b
l
i
sh() and ca
p
_free()
commit
|
commitdiff
|
tree
2017-10-12
Jakub Jermar
Allocate capabil
i
ties
f
rom a dedicated slab cac
h
e
commit
|
commitdiff
|
tree
2017-10-10
Jak
u
b
J
er
m
a
r
Allow ca
p
s_task_alloc() to fail
commit
|
commitdiff
|
tree
2017-10-09
Jakub Jermar
Allow v
i
rtually unlim
i
ted number of capabil
i
t
ies per
.
.
.
commit
|
commitdiff
|
tree
2017-10-09
Jakub Jermar
Resource aren
a
s
should be d
e
structible
commit
|
commitdiff
|
tree
2017-10-09
J
a
kub
Je
r
ma
r
Remove u
n
used
enums
commit
|
commitdiff
|
tree
2017-10-08
Ja
k
ub Jerma
r
Replace
t
he old
hash table
im
p
l
ementation in th
e
kernel
.
.
.
commit
|
commitdiff
|
tree
2017-09-30
Jakub Jermar
Let the resource
a
llocator treat
0 as a valid r
e
source
commit
|
commitdiff
|
tree
2017-09-30
Jakub Je
r
m
a
r
Mer
g
e support
f
or c
a
pabilities from
l
p:~jakub/helenos
.
.
.
commit
|
commitdiff
|
tree
2017-09-29
Jakub J
e
rmar
Add c
o
mm
e
nts
commit
|
commitdiff
|
tree
2017-09-28
Jakub Jermar
Introduce r
e
f
e
rence-cou
n
t
e
d k
o
bjects
commit
|
commitdiff
|
tree
2017-09-26
Jakub
Jer
m
ar
Do not return unde
f
in
e
d va
l
ue
commit
|
commitdiff
|
tree
2017-09-19
Jakub Jer
m
ar
Remove
c
ap from type list when r
e
claiming
commit
|
commitdiff
|
tree
2017-09-19
J
a
k
ub Je
r
mar
Rename caps_ap
p
ly_
t
o_all to c
a
ps
_
apply_
t
o_type
commit
|
commitdiff
|
tree
2017-09-18
J
akub Jerm
a
r
Make al
l
acces
s
es to
cap
a
b
ilites exclus
i
ve
commit
|
commitdiff
|
tree
2017-09-14
J
a
kub Jermar
Do not i
r
r
i
tate the assembler by FSTPL %
s
p(1)
commit
|
commitdiff
|
tree
2017-09-04
Jakub Jerm
a
r
Create a slab
cache for allocating
p
h
one_t structur
e
s
commit
|
commitdiff
|
tree
2017-09-04
Jakub Jermar
Crea
t
e
a slab cache for
a
llocatin
g
irq_t struct
u
res
commit
|
commitdiff
|
tree
2017-09-04
Jakub Jermar
F
ix getting
o
f the kobject add
r
ess
commit
|
commitdiff
|
tree
2017-09-04
Jaku
b
Jermar
A
lloca
t
e
t
h
e
k
o
b
jects referenced by capabilities dynamic
a
lly
commit
|
commitdiff
|
tree
2017-09-03
Jakub Jermar
Improve comments
commit
|
commitdiff
|
tree
2017-09-03
Jakub Jermar
Improv
e
comments
commit
|
commitdiff
|
tree
2017-09-03
Jakub
Jermar
Do
not regist
e
r IRQs inside of answerboxes
commit
|
commitdiff
|
tree
2017-09-03
J
akub Jermar
Make IRQ
s
ubscri
b
e/unsubscribe thread safe aga
i
n
commit
|
commitdiff
|
tree
2017-09-03
Jakub
J
ermar
Remov
e
unused co
n
nection
c
l
o
ning
commit
|
commitdiff
|
tree
2017-09-03
Jakub
Jermar
I
m
p
rove comments
commit
|
commitdiff
|
tree
2017-08-30
Jakub Jermar
Upgrade to QEMU 2
.
10
.
0
commit
|
commitdiff
|
tree
2017-08-22
J
a
k
u
b
Jermar
I
nclude ta
s
k I
D
in connecti
o
n hash table operatio
n
s
commit
|
commitdiff
|
tree
2017-08-22
Jaku
b
J
e
r
mar
Copy entir
e
i
p
c_data_t t
o
us
p
ace on
a
n
s
w
er
commit
|
commitdiff
|
tree
2017-08-22
Jakub J
e
rmar
Fix d
o
xygen comments
commit
|
commitdiff
|
tree
2017-08-20
J
a
kub Jermar
Do no
t
access the
capability table dir
e
c
tly in phone_
a
lloc()
commit
|
commitdiff
|
tree
2017-08-20
Jakub Jermar
St
o
re capability's ha
n
dle
inside
of it
commit
|
commitdiff
|
tree
next